On Education.com, 5th-grade ball games for grammar and mechanics combine physical activity with language arts skill practice. Examples include games where students pass a ball while identifying parts of speech, sentence punctuation, or verb tense, making learning interactive and engaging. These activities help reinforce grammar concepts while incorporating movement, alerting students to apply their knowledge in a fun, memorable way.
